Output 2fb98e045826c2991faad47b15e7d60ab947619123cd396dfaf221b5a2d13463:12

value
66225230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c3f7646398f519f25aa5ea0cfd48866822382a OP_EQUAL
address
M8LMhBPjWdVVZTBkFY2XijNAMbtSvE4222
transaction
2fb98e045826c2991faad47b15e7d60ab947619123cd396dfaf221b5a2d13463
spent
true